GAZA: China condemns US veto in UNSC truce vote

BEIJING: China warned Wednesday (21st Feb, 2024) that a US decision to veto a UNSC resolution calling for an immediate ceasefire in Gaza pushed the conflict into an “even more dangerous” situation. Washington on Tuesday (20th Feb, 2024) vetoed a UNSC resolution drafted by Algeria, which demanded an immediate humanitarian ceasefire in war-torn Gaza and […]
